Transaction 50f6745f111cedb7792b532047537306d118eb61317ab0eedf42638126e2d950
1 Input
1 Output
-
50f6745f111cedb7792b532047537306d118eb61317ab0eedf42638126e2d950:0
- value
- 16258995
- script pubkey
- OP_0 OP_PUSHBYTES_20 68c27ddc8dd393df28771c4e98ec8d18b746a0bc
- address
- bc1qdrp8mhyd6wfa72rhr38f3mydrzm5dg9u42kx2q